Throwing herself into the library, Alexia began her search.

Scanning the the tall shelves, she weaved in and out of rows. Her eyes strained from the lack of sleep and low light.

Pursing her lips she read the titles, her finger tips grazing the binding as she went. She did not have much time but her endless questions were eating away at her.

Tucking the books she felt were promising under arm, she continued her search.

Her search was proving to be harder than she predicted. She now understood how Caspian had been unsuccessful.

As the sun was rising even higher she knew her time was limited. Gathering up a few books that had peaked her interest, she took them back to her quarters.

They smelt of dust and looked as if they may fall apart at her very touch. She carefully placed them on a table before scurrying out the room.

The palace was starting to become more lively as people were waking from their slumber. By the end of the day most would return home to there home packs, allowing the palace to return to its normal routine.

The servants she passed, bowed. They were busy collecting discarded glasses and various items they found. Alexia made a mental note to ensure every servant was rewarded for their hard work. The hall had been a smashing success. The headlines of the papers sung its praises. The world now new she was the queen and there was no going back.

Walking through the hallways, she could hear low murmurs coming through the doors of the meeting room as she approached.

The guards seeing her stood at attention giving her a slight bow.

She was greeted by blood shot eyes and half hearted bows. With a gracious smile, she accepted the gesture. Her body feeling heavy from her own lack of sleep.

The guests milled about the room. The servants had laid out a spread on one side the room. Many alphas were munching away on the food and drinking the coffee as if it was the only thing keeping them alive. Light conversation in low voices was made amongst them.

Caspian was already at the front of the room conversing. She admired him. Watching him, he seemed alert and showed no signs of fatigue. His body radiated strengthen.

Gabe moved about the room swiftly as he directed servants to various tasks.

Stationed near the back, Enzo watched. His tired eyes alert.

The grand clock rang, chiming the hour at which they had agreed to meet. Signaling for the room to become still.

The alphas directed their attention to Caspian who stood at the front of the room. Alexia made her way to stand off to the side behind him.

She watched the alphas from her position. The queen mother had decided to retire to her bed chambers and very few Lunas decided to attend with their mates. Leaving Alexia to be one of a few women that were present.

“Good Morning Everyone, I want to thank you for coming so early but I wished to speak to before you made your way home.” Caspian greeted them.

Heads nodded with a few words that were unable to be discerned in response.

Caspian began. “I will make this brief as I am sure we all have many tasks to attend to.”

The tired eyes around the room were response enough.

“As you all know we have been experiencing an increase in rogue activity-” Sparking a few murmurs of agreement.

Slipping in the back, Jacob and Luca silently entered as the King spoke.

“It has not gone unnoticed and we have begun an investigation in order to better understand. A representative will be sent to each pack to assess any threats to help us better fight off these attackers. “

“A representative? So you’re going to send a random warrior into our lands.” A foolish young alpha spoke from his seat.

The room was suddenly more awake and alert at the underhanded challenge. Alphas were on the edge of their seats, calculating their positions if a fight were to occur.

Caspian kept his composure. “Actually not a warrior but an alpha. I believe you all know Luca Silver.” He said gesturing to Alexia’s brother who was standing next to her father in the back.

The foolish young alpha’s shoulders slumped at the recognition of the name Silver. Turning towards the back, his head dipped in defeat. Luca stared directly at alpha with an unflinching gaze and his arms crossed as he leaned against the wall. The action caused the young alpha to shrink away even more. A warrior was one thing but the son of one of the most powerful alphas was another.

The group settled back down seemingly pleased by the response. The Silvers were known to fierce warriors and honorable men.

In the crowd Alexia saw Alpha Dennis whispering into the ear of the Alpha next to him. She searched her memory trying to remember his name but before she could temper his hand was raised.

“Yes, Alpha Howard.” Caspian said answering her question as he called on the Alpha to speak.

“What if these attempts are unsuccessful?” He questioned with a nod of approval from Alpha Dennis as if he was encouraging him.

After talking with her father, Alexia had learned several things about the alpha. First, his pack was strong with a large territory and various resources. Making him hold a good deal of power. Second, he had served as an advisor to Caspian’s father in his cabinet no matter how much Jacob had protested. Third, above all he was not to be trusted.

Angling her head, she wondered what game he was playing. Could he want to over throw Caspian? He had no sons so it seemed unlikely but his presence made Alexia’s skin crawl.

“We have the upmost confidence that the measures we are taking will prove to be quiet fruitful.” Caspian swept through his question diplomatically.

But the alpha was not pleased with the answer Caspian gave. Again he questioned the king, this time projecting his voice louder. “So we stand by and just follow along while our packs out at risk?”

He statement caused the others to whispher amongst themselves. Caspian’s eyes narrowed but did not respond.

The older alpha seemed to be more bold than the younger one. “You can’t even be bothered to go yourself, instead you send some untested kid in your stead!”

Gasps spread through the room at the daring words. The once bloodshot eyes of the attendees were now gone and replaced with bright round eyes, on edge waiting to see what would unfold before them.

In a calm but viscous voice that could have been classified as a snarl Caspian spoke. “Are you saying I do not care about my people?”

A pen drop could be heard in the room, many afraid to breathe. Enzo’s eyes turned feral.

“If you are working so hard, why are still having these attacks?” He said as stood looking to all the alphas in the room, trying to gain their support.

“We have been taking the necessary steps-“ Caspian said before he was cut off. His self restraint beginning to snap.

“If you can’t handle this, then maybe we need someone to lead us who can. A new king.” Alpha Howard said cutting him off.
